Heat helps reduce pain by relaxing and loosening tense muscles, and it promotes blood and nutrients to speed healing. Put an ice pack on your back for 10 to 20 minutes to reduce nerve activity, pain, and swelling. When using heat therapy, the heat source should be warm, as tolerated, and not hot. As a general rule, heat therapy can be used for 15 to 20 minutes, with breaks in between to avoid skin damage. Using heat at other times — a warm compress, heating pad or a hot bath can help relax muscles that may be tense.
